Transaction 38bb57779c16364650aa2b151e740b407ed870def803b0e12e5e213373d9ecb0
1 Input
1 Output
-
38bb57779c16364650aa2b151e740b407ed870def803b0e12e5e213373d9ecb0:0
- value
- 620288
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c203addda755f62e64672c605b446ff6ff415eb
- address
- bc1qpssr4hw6w40k9ejxwtrqtdzxlahlg90t05pm8v